What a check portrait photography contract template signed electronically is and why it matters

A check portrait photography contract template signed electronically is a standardized portrait photography agreement prepared for digital execution using an electronic signature platform. It captures client details, model or parental consent, usage and licensing terms, payment schedules, and retainer conditions, then secures signatures and timestamps using cryptographic methods. For portrait photographers this replaces paper forms, speeds client onboarding, and centralizes version control and retention. When implemented with compliant eSignature services, the template supports audit trails, signer authentication, and secure storage to reduce disputes and improve administrative efficiency.

Common challenges when switching to electronic portrait contracts

  • Poorly formatted templates can omit model release language or licensing details and create legal ambiguity.
  • Weak signer authentication increases exposure to identity disputes and undermines contract enforceability.
  • Inconsistent storage or backup practices risk loss of signed releases or failure to meet retention policies.
  • Not aligning templates with state ESIGN/UETA rules or sector rules (HIPAA/FERPA) can cause compliance gaps.

Best practices for accurate and secure electronically signed portrait contracts

Follow these operational and legal practices to minimize risk and ensure reliable use of electronic portrait contract templates.

Include clear model release and usage terms
Write precise licensing clauses that specify permitted uses, geographic scope, duration, and whether sublicensing or commercial use is allowed; avoid vague terms that invite disputes and document any special permissions separately.
Use appropriate signer authentication
Match authentication strength to risk—simple email for low-risk individual sessions, multi-factor or ID verification for commercial or high-value licensing agreements to support enforceability.
Maintain an immutable audit trail
Ensure the platform stores tamper-evident signing logs, IP and timestamp data, and version history to support enforcement and defend against later challenges.
Retain signed records with a clear policy
Adopt a retention schedule that aligns with legal requirements and client expectations, with secure backups and access controls for archived portrait releases.
